Do people from western countries use chilly in their food ?

Western countries is a very general term as there is a great diversity among their cuisines. It is as misleading as using the term Asian food to cover Chinese, Indian, Japanese, Thai, etc.
The Europians, in general, do not use much chillies, except for sweet capsicum. But Hungarian paprika is an essential element to Hungarian food. Mexicans love chillies and use around 8 varieties of them. Americans make Tabasco sauce. It is a hot sauce made from a particular variety of chillies.
